Definitions of cause:

  • noun:   a justification for something existing or happening
    Example: "He had no cause to complain"
  • noun:   events that provide the generative force that is the origin of something
    Example: "They are trying to determine the cause of the crash"
  • noun:   any entity that causes events to happen
  • noun:   a series of actions advancing a principle or tending toward a particular end
    Example: "They worked in the cause of world peace"
  • noun:   a comprehensive term for any proceeding in a court of law whereby an individual seeks a legal remedy
  • verb:   give rise to; cause to happen or occur, not always intentionally
    Example: "Cause a commotion"
  • verb:   cause to do; cause to act in a specified manner
